Subject: [outages] Seemingly Nationwide Comcast DNS Outage

Seeing many recent reports on the interwebs regarding a “nationwide Comcast 
outage”.
Looks like it’s an issue with Comcast DNS (75.75.75.75 / 75.75.76.76) and not 
anything else, as queries to other public DNS servers (ex: 1.1.1.1 / 8.8.8.8) 
work just fine over my Comcast service.

For reference, I’m located in Chicago, but I did perform NSLookup’s from a box 
in NYC, Dallas, and Seattle which resulted in similar behavior as seen below.

nslookup google.com 75.75.75.75
Server:  UnKnown
Address:  75.75.75.75
*** UnKnown can't find google.com: Query refused

nslookup google.com 75.75.76.76
Server:  UnKnown
Address:  75.75.76.76
*** UnKnown can't find google.com: Query refused

nslookup google.com 1.1.1.1
Server:  one.one.one.one
Address:  1.1.1.1

Non-authoritative answer:
Name:    google.com
Addresses:  2607:f8b0:4009:812::200e
          172.217.5.14

nslookup google.com 8.8.8.8
Server:  dns.google
Address:  8.8.8.8

Non-authoritative answer:
Name:    google.com
Addresses:  2607:f8b0:4009:80f::200e
          216.58.192.238
